Exegesis
A metaphorical comparison in ki-šnê śā-kîr {כִּשְׁנֵי שָׂכִיר | ki-šnê śā-kîr} ‘as the years of a hired worker’ uses the comparative prefix and construct dual.
In context — Isaiah 16:14
And now the LORD has spoken, saying, “Within three years, as the years of a hired worker , the glory of Moab will be brought into contempt among all that great multitude, and the remnant will be very small, not mighty.”
